Android Studio Emulator

Android Studio Emulator is a part of the official Android development environment. It is designed for app developers and offers a high-fidelity simulation of various Android devices. While it may not be the best choice for casual gamers, it is an excellent option for developers who want to test their games on a variety of devices and Android API levels.

To use the Android Studio Emulator, follow these steps:

  1. Download and install Android Studio from the official website.
  2. Launch Android Studio and set up your development environment.
  3. Create a new virtual device by selecting the desired Android device configuration.
  4. Customize the virtual device settings and choose the desired Android API level.
  5. Once the virtual device is set up, launch it.
  6. Install your developed or downloaded Android games on the virtual device.
  7. Test and debug your games using the Android Studio Emulator.

PrimeOS

PrimeOS is an operating system based on Android that can be installed on a PC. It offers a complete Android experience and allows you to play Android games natively without an emulator.

To use PrimeOS, follow these steps:

  1. Download the PrimeOS installer from the official website.
  2. Create a bootable USB drive using the PrimeOS installer.
  3. Restart your PC and boot from the USB drive.
  4. Follow the on-screen instructions to install PrimeOS on your PC.
  5. Once installed, you can boot into PrimeOS and access the Google Play Store to download and play Android games.

ARChon

ARChon is a unique Android emulator that allows you to run Android apps on any operating system that supports the Google Chrome browser. It provides a simple and lightweight solution for running Android games on your PC.

To use ARChon, follow these steps:

  1. Download the ARChon runtime from the official GitHub repository.
  2. Extract the ARChon runtime files to a folder on your PC.
  3. Open the Google Chrome browser and navigate to the Extensions page.
  4. Enable Developer Mode in the Extensions page.
  5. Click on “Load unpacked extension” and select the folder containing the ARChon runtime files.
  6. Once the ARChon runtime is installed as a Chrome extension, you can run Android apps by packaging them as Chrome apps.
  7. Download your desired Android games as APK files and convert them into Chrome apps using tools like “Chrome APK Packager.”
  8. Install the converted Chrome apps and start playing Android games on your PC using ARChon.
